ISLAMABAD – Pakistan Navy took over the command of Combined Maritime TaskForce 150 (CTF-150) from Royal Canadian Navy at an impressive change ofcommand ceremony held at Headquarters US NAVCENT, Bahrain.
According to a press release issued here by Directorate of Public Relationsof Pakistan Navy, Commodore Alveer Ahmed Noor of Pakistan Navy took overthe command of CTF-150 from Commodore Darren Garnier of Royal Canadian Navy.
The change of command ceremony was graced by Vice Admiral James J. Malloy,Commander US Naval Forces Central Command/Commander US FifthFleet/Commander Combined Maritime Forces.
In addition, the ceremony was also attended by Commander of the CanadianJoint Operations Command, Commander of the Royal Bahrain Naval Forces, repsof Ambassador of Pakistan to Bahrain and Ambassador of Canada to Kuwait andother Senior Officers from foreign navies.

Pakistan Navy had the distinction of commanding TF-150 for 10 differenttimes prior to present Command which is manifestation of the trust andrespect reposed in Pakistan Navy by the coalition partners.
Over the years, while protecting Pakistan’s maritime interests, PakistanNavy has been actively participating in international coalition operationsto ensure peace and maritime security in the region.
CTF-150 is one of the three Task Forces operating within the ambit ofCombined Maritime Forces (CMF). Its mission is to promote maritime securityin order to counter terrorist acts and related illegal activitiesperpetrated by the terrorists’ networks.
It is a multi-national coalition for counter-terrorism operations at sea insupport of Operation Enduring Freedom (OEF) with the mission to promotemaritime security at sea; deter, deny and disrupt acts of terrorism whilecountering related illicit activities at sea.
